CdM improves to 3-0

Share via

ROLLING HILLS ESTATE - Corona del Mar high’s girls water polo team

continued its winning way with an 8-3 trouncing of host Peninsula

Wednesday.

Two-meter player Melinda Tucker scored four goals in the first half as

CdM took a 6-2 halftime lead. Hayley Hapeman scored three times, twice in

the second half, and Danielle Carlson got the other goal. Goalie Arin

Hendrickson had eight saves for CdM (3-0).
